Île Ronde
Île Ronde is an islet in Quebec, Canada. Île Ronde is situated nearby to the hamlet Plage-Paul, as well as near Plage-Héritage.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Père-Louis-Marie Ecological Reserve
Nature reserve
Père-Louis-Marie Ecological Reserve is an ecological reserve in Quebec, Canada. It was established on May 12, 1993. Père-Louis-Marie Ecological Reserve is situated 4 km south of Île Ronde.
